**Service Accounts: Bulk Edits in the Admin Table (Thornquist Console)**

Bulk edits on service accounts go through the admin table at `/console/svc-accounts`. Select rows, pick an action (disable, rotate, reassign owner), confirm. Max 200 rows per batch. Edits are queued, not instant — check the audit tab for status. Don't bulk-disable accounts tagged `critical` without sign-off. All bulk operations call the internal accounts service under the hood, and your session needs a service key to authorize them. Use the contractor staging key below:

API key for tajop-tagaf: zpat15_wFKIn9d85K88goH

## Runbook: Gaugepile Sidecar — Release Checklist

Heads up: the sidecar ships with every app pod, so a bad config fans out fast. Before cutting a release, confirm the flush interval hasn't drifted from what the Tallyhouse aggregator expects, or you'll see sawtooth gaps in dashboards. Rollbacks are cheap — just repin the image tag. Canary one node pool first, watch for ten minutes, then proceed. The values to verify against are these.

config for bagep-yafof:
quenath:
  pin: 8584
  metrics_host: metrics.quenath.tolvaqsys.internal
  tenant: pelath
  seal: seal_ed102645

TURN-208: Gatevale turnstile counters at the Merrow Field pilot double-count when a rotation reverses mid-cycle. Attendance totals drift roughly 2% high per event. The debounce window fix is implemented, reviewed by Ilsa, and soak-tested across two simulated match days without drift. Ready for your cut; the candidate build is identified below.

trace token, tagag-tafog: htk6_5ed18c

Quick refresher for anyone fielding "why didn't my webhook arrive" tickets about Pondrel. Deliveries retry with exponential backoff: 5 attempts over roughly 40 minutes, controlled by WEBHOOK_MAX_ATTEMPTS and WEBHOOK_BACKOFF_BASE. A 2xx stops retries; anything else queues another try. After the final failure the endpoint gets flagged in the Driftgate dashboard, so check there before escalating. Each retry is signed so customers can verify it's really us, and the signing secret is set on the following line.

env line for fafof-fahag: LEDGER_TOKEN5=f8790